Table 2.
Socio-demographic characteristics of participants
| Variable | Frequency (N = 83) | Percentage (%) |
|---|---|---|
| Age | ||
| 18–25 | 20 | 24.8 |
| 26–39 | 42 | 49.7 |
| 40+ | 21 | 25.5 |
| Sex | ||
| Male | 32 | 38.6 |
| Female | 51 | 61.4 |
| Ethnicity | ||
| Kassena | 43 | 51.8 |
| Nankana | 40 | 48.2 |
| Marital status | ||
| Never married | 13 | 15.7 |
| Married | 66 | 79.5 |
| Widowed | 4 | 4.8 |
| Educational status | ||
| No education | 22 | 26.5 |
| Primary/ Junior high | 42 | 50.6 |
| Senior high/Tertiary | 17 | 22.9 |
| Occupation | ||
| Unemployed | 13 | 15.7 |
| Civil/public servant | 3 | 3.6 |
| Self employed | 30 | 36.1 |
| Farmer | 37 | 44.6 |
| Household monthly income (GH¢) | ||
| 100–400 | 29 | 35.0 |
| 401–700 | 7 | 8.4 |
| 701+ | 5 | 6.0 |
| Unable to tell | 42 | 50.6 |
